Had Avast Premier for years.
It stopped updating virus definitions or the program itself about a year or so ago.
When I uninstalled it, it made me lose my ethernet connection.
On Windows 8.1.

So I kept it & updated it manually.

Now I have the latest version of Windows 10 Pro.


With 8.1 & 10 Pro(earlier versions) I lost my ethernet connection after uninstalling Avast Premeir.

In desperation I downloaded the free version of Avast & installed it OVER the installed version of Avast Premier.
It replaced the Premier version totally.

Today I used Revo Uninstaller to remove the Avast Free version.
Only after using Macrium Reflect to make a complete system image of my OS.

After Avast was removed I still had my internet connection. :)

Windows Defender started automatically.

Never again will I use any Avast product.
